Household of Johanna Pastoor

She is married to Harm Slomp.

They got married on April 22, 1904 at Hoogeveen nederland, she was 23 years old.


Child(ren):

  1. Egbertje Slomp  1904-1907
  2. Hendrik Slomp  1905- 
  3. Albert Slomp  1908-1993 
  4. Janna Slomp  1911-1988 
  5. Hendrikje Slomp  1915-1918
  6. Egbert Slomp  1918-1997
